Palmetto Dunes Oceanfront Resort, Hilton Head

  • When it comes to tennis in the Palmetto State, two words usually come to mind: Hilton Head. The Lowcountry barrier island is a tennis vacation nirvana. Palmetto Dunes Oceanfront Resort, one of the area’s most popular destinations for family getaways, personifies the beach town allure, with three miles of Atlantic Ocean beach, a marina, a lagoon-system, three golf courses—and a highly regarded tennis center, which boasts a whopping 19 clay courts, four lit for night play. Hilton Head is also home to Van der Meer Tennis, the academy founded by coach Dennis Van der Meer, and The Sea Pines Resort, where Stan Smith was once the touring pro.

Montage Palmetto Bluff, Bluffton

  • In between Hilton Head and Savannah, Montage Palmetto Bluff, in Bluffton, offers a fairytale-style retreat on what was a private hunting reserve of the Rockefellers. With access to three rivers and an abundance of pine and live oaks, Palmetto Bluff is a sprawling natural wonderland made for hiking, biking, fishing, sports shooting, horseback riding, golf and, of course, tennis. The Wilson Lawn and Racquet Club has eight Har-Tru courts, along with six pickleball and two bocce courts.

Kiawah Island Golf Resort, Kiawah Island

  • Another popular vacation spot is Kiawah Island, where the Kiawah Island Golf Resort offers packages that combine accommodations with instruction or court time at the Roy Barth Tennis Center. This is both a serious and picturesque setting, with 22 courts surrounded by S.C.’s signature palmetto trees and fragrant blooms.

Wild Dunes Resort, Charleston

  • In the Charleston area, travelers looking to combine court and beach time with city exploration can stay at Wild Dunes Resort, where the Tennis Center has 17 Har-Tru courts. Accommodation options at the resort recently expanded to include Sweetgrass Inn, a new hotel of 153 rooms and suites. Also new is the Spa at Sweetgrass, a convenient place to unwind and pamper yourself post-match.

LTP Daniel Island, Daniel Island

  • While Daniel Island Club’s Tennis Pavilion is only open to club members, LTP Daniel Island, home of the Volvo Car Open, allows visitors to book court time and clinics via its Pate Academy.
